Guys, use the regular UCI #, the new UCI# starting with CAN is just a temporary UCI created by system but after they do first eligibility oand completion check they update account to show your regular old UCI#.
UCI is your lifetime thing and will or should never change as that connects your whole history in system. There is a question in form if you already have UCI#, that is where you quote your old UCI#
